Does Christies International Real Estate guarantee the success of the business at an approved location?

Christies_International_Real_Estate Franchise · 2025 FDD

Answer from 2025 FDD Document

In addition, any recommendations, suggestions, or approvals of a proposed site are not a warranty, guarantee or representation that the site will achieve any level or amount of sales, revenue or profit as a CHRISTIE'S INTERNATIONAL REAL ESTATE business location.

You acknowledge and agree that your acceptance of the obligation to develop the CHRISTIE'S INTERNATIONAL REAL ESTATE business is based on your own independent investigation of the suitability of the site for the CHRISTIE'S INTERNATIONAL REAL ESTATE business.

What This Means (2025 FDD)

According to Christies International Real Estate's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, the franchisor does not guarantee any level of success at an approved location. Even though Christies International Real Estate must give written consent for a proposed site and may even offer recommendations or suggestions, these approvals do not constitute a warranty or guarantee that the location will achieve any specific level of sales, revenue, or profit.

This means that while Christies International Real Estate reserves the right to approve a franchisee's proposed site, the ultimate responsibility for the site's success rests with the franchisee. The franchisee is expected to conduct their own independent investigation to determine if the site is suitable for their Christies International Real Estate business. This includes assessing factors such as local market conditions, demographics, competition, and accessibility.

This is a common practice in franchising, as franchisors typically do not have enough local expertise to accurately predict the success of a specific location. Prospective Christies International Real Estate franchisees should carefully consider this and conduct thorough due diligence before committing to a location. This due diligence should include market research, financial projections, and consultation with experienced real estate professionals.
